Market Sizing, Growth Estimates, and CAGR Projections

Based on recent industry data, the South Korean EDM market was valued at approximately USD 1.2 billion in 2023. This valuation encompasses both wire EDM and sinker EDM segments, serving diverse end-user industries. The market is projected to grow at a compound annual growth rate (CAGR) of 7.5% to 8.0% over the next five years, reaching an estimated USD 1.8 billion by 2028.

Assumptions underlying these projections include:

  • Continued expansion of high-precision manufacturing sectors in South Korea, especially in automotive and electronics.
  • Increasing adoption of advanced EDM technologies, including hybrid systems and automation integration.
  • Government initiatives supporting Industry 4.0 and smart manufacturing, fostering technological upgrades.
  • Steady growth in export demand for precision components, particularly in aerospace and medical sectors.

Market Ecosystem and Operational Framework

Key Product Categories

  • Wire EDM: Predominant in manufacturing complex, fine features in hard metals, accounting for approximately 65% of market revenue.
  • Sinker EDM: Used for roughing and forming large, intricate cavities, representing around 35% of the market.

Stakeholders and Demand-Supply Framework

  • Manufacturers of EDM Machines: Leading global players like Sodick, Mitsubishi Electric, and local innovators such as DAEHAN Precision.
  • Raw Material Suppliers: Providers of high-grade copper, graphite electrodes, dielectric fluids, and precision components.
  • End-Users: Automotive OEMs, electronics manufacturers, aerospace firms, medical device companies, and research institutions.
  • Distributors and Service Providers: Regional distributors, after-sales service providers, and system integrators.

Value Chain and Revenue Models

  1. Raw Material Sourcing: Procurement of electrodes, dielectric fluids, and precision components, with cost contributions of approximately 20-25% of total manufacturing costs.
  2. Manufacturing and System Integration: Assembly of EDM machines, customization, and integration with automation and digital control systems.
  3. Distribution and After-Sales Services: Revenue streams include machine sales, consumables, spare parts, and maintenance contracts.
  4. Lifecycle Services: Training, upgrades, and remote diagnostics, fostering long-term customer relationships and recurring revenue.

Digital Transformation and Industry 4.0 Integration

The evolution towards Industry 4.0 is reshaping the EDM landscape in South Korea. Key trends include:

  • Smart Systems and IoT: Embedding sensors and connectivity for real-time monitoring, predictive maintenance, and process optimization.
  • System Interoperability: Adoption of standardized communication protocols (e.g., OPC UA) facilitates seamless integration with enterprise resource planning (ERP) and manufacturing execution systems (MES).
  • Data Analytics and AI: Leveraging big data and AI algorithms to enhance precision, reduce cycle times, and optimize electrode wear.
  • Cross-Industry Collaborations: Partnerships between EDM manufacturers and software firms accelerate innovation, enabling hybrid machining solutions and automation.

Adoption Trends and End-User Insights

Major end-user segments exhibit distinct adoption patterns:

  • Electronics & Semiconductor: High adoption of micro-EDM for wafer-level processing, with a focus on miniaturization and high throughput.
  • Automotive: Increasing use of EDM for complex engine components, mold making, and lightweight structural parts.
  • Aerospace: Precision machining of turbine blades, structural components, and tooling, with a trend towards hybrid machining solutions.
  • Medical Devices: Growing demand for intricate, biocompatible components requiring micro-EDM capabilities.

Consumption patterns are shifting towards integrated, automated systems, reducing cycle times and enhancing quality control.
